Are millennials killing off sit-down chain restaurants like Applebee's and TGI Fridays?

That's the theory being discussed after a story in Business Insider quoted Buffalo Wild Wings CEO Sally Smith in a story on the topic.

“Casual-dining restaurants face a uniquely challenging market today,” she told Business Insider's Kate Taylor, Business Insider's retail reporter.

“Millennial consumers are more attracted than their elders to cooking at home, ordering delivery from restaurants and eating quickly, in fast-casual or quick-serve restaurants,” Smith wrote.

Delivery kits like Blue Apron, quick places like Chipotle Mexican Grill or Panera Bread, all are playing a role. Some of the sit-down chains are beginning to offer delivery.
